一个公网IP地址理论上可以支持无限数量的电脑联网,但这并不意味着所有电脑都能同时进行网络通信。在实际应用中,一个公网IP地址支持多少台电脑主要取决于网络架构、NAT(Network Address Translation,网络地址转换)技术的应用以及TCP/IP协议栈的设计。
NAT技术:在大多数的家庭和小型企业网络中,通过路由器使用NAT技术,一个公网IP地址可以支持多台内部设备(包括电脑、手机、平板等)访问互联网。这是因为NAT技术允许多个私有IP地址共享一个公网IP地址,通过内部的端口映射来区分不同的设备和网络连接。
端口资源:每个公网IP地址有65535个端口,通过NAT,每一个内部设备的网络连接会占用一个或多个端口。理论上讲,只要端口资源充足并且没有达到极限,就可以支持更多的设备连接。但实际上,随着设备数量增多,网络管理复杂度和安全隐患会增大。
服务器场景:对于服务器应用场景,如果需要对外提供服务(例如网站服务器、邮件服务器等),通常一台服务器配一个公网IP地址,但这台服务器可以为无数客户端提供服务,这里的客户端数量不受公网IP的限制。
服务提供商限制:在某些网络服务提供商那里,可能会对单一公网IP地址的最大连接数做出限制。
在家庭或小型企业网络中,一个公网IP地址通常可以支持数十至上百台设备通过NAT技术上网,而在服务器场景下,公网IP地址则是用来标识服务器,它可以服务于数量庞大的客户端。但无论如何,实际承载量会受限于NAT转换表的大小、网络设备性能以及服务提供商的策略等因素。
还没有评论,来说两句吧...